Output 5ea520583ae4cb56be9473eb50a6f591140a26f7a26bd9a180e17ca9936d0808:80

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86dc290018f4faf69eec0bc8033e5229c07a08aa268234163ed5e8f34b2dc356
address
bc1psmwzjqqc7na0d8hvp0yqx0jj98q85z92y6prg9376h50xjedcdtqp4df8j
transaction
5ea520583ae4cb56be9473eb50a6f591140a26f7a26bd9a180e17ca9936d0808
spent
true